Low audio from product | Lifestyle® 650 home entertainment system

Be sure the system is set up properly and all connections are secure.

A connection may have come loose or may be connected incorrectly. For more info, see Setting up your product.

Check the bass and treble controls for your product.

Be sure the bass and treble adjustments are not set too high or too low for your preferences. For more info, see Adjusting the tone controls on your product.

Reset your product.

Much like rebooting a smartphone, your product might need to be reset on occasion to correct minor issues. For more information, see Resetting your product.

Try a different audio device.

Connect and play another audio device through your product. This can help determine if the issue is isolated to the first device.

Run the ADAPTiQ audio calibration to optimize the sound of your system.

Since different environments affect how sound is heard, use ADAPTiQ can calibrate you system. It listens to how your speakers sound in your room, then adjusts the sound as needed to optimize sound quality. For more info, see ADAPTiQ system setup and deactivation.

Check the condition of the speaker wires and be sure they are secure at both ends.

Check the speaker wires for any kinks, scratches, cuts or damage. Replace any damaged wires and check that they are securely connected at both ends.
